Casey Kelly is expected to make his big-league debut with the Padres on Monday, according to the San Diego Union-Tribune's Bill Center.

Kelly, who was traded along with Anthony Rizzo from the Red Sox to the Padres for Adrian Gonzalez, has made three starts in Double-A while recovering from an elbow injury, going 0-1 with a 3.78 ERA in 16.2 innings.

Kelly would be inheriting the rotation spot of Jason Marquis, who was placed on the disabled list Aug. 23 with a fractured wrist. A 2012 return for Marquis hasn't been ruled out.
